Things to do near
Midland, Texas

  • Permian Basin Petroleum Museum - Located in Midland, this museum offers a deep dive into the history and technology of the oil industry, featuring interactive exhibits and historical artifacts.

  • I-20 Wildlife Preserve - Situated in Midland, this urban playa habitat provides walking trails, birdwatching opportunities, and educational programs about local wildlife.

  • Sibley Nature Center - Found in nearby Odessa (about 20 miles from Midland), this center focuses on the natural history of West Texas with trails, gardens, and educational exhibits.

  • Wagner Noël Performing Arts Center - Located between Midland and Odessa (approximately 15 miles from Midland), this venue hosts concerts, theater productions, and other cultural events throughout the year.

  • Odessa Meteor Crater - About 30 miles from Midland in Odessa. This site features one of the largest meteor craters in the United States along with a visitor center that provides insights into its formation.

  • Monahans Sandhills State Park - Approximately 60 miles southwest of Midland. This park offers unique sand dunes for hiking or sandboarding as well as picnic areas for family outings.

  • Big Spring State Park - Around 40 miles east of Midland. The park features scenic drives with panoramic views of West Texas landscapes along with hiking trails and picnic spots.
